package k8sutil
import (
"context"
"testing"
"github.com/stretchr/testify/assert"
v1 "k8s.io/api/core/v1"
storagev1 "k8s.io/api/storage/v1"
apiresource "k8s.io/apimachinery/pkg/api/resource"
metav1 "k8s.io/apimachinery/pkg/apis/meta/v1"
"sigs.k8s.io/controller-runtime/pkg/client"
"sigs.k8s.io/controller-runtime/pkg/client/fake"
)
func TestExpandPVCIfRequired(t *testing.T) {
testcases := []struct {
label string
currentPVCSize string
desiredPVCSize string
expansionAllowed bool
}{
{
label: "case 1: size is equal",
currentPVCSize: "1Mi",
desiredPVCSize: "1Mi",
expansionAllowed: true,
},
{
label: "case 2: current size is less",
currentPVCSize: "1Mi",
desiredPVCSize: "2Mi",
expansionAllowed: true,
},
{
label: "case 3: current size is more",
currentPVCSize: "2Mi",
desiredPVCSize: "1Mi",
expansionAllowed: true,
},
{
label: "case 4: storage class allows expansion",
currentPVCSize: "1Mi",
desiredPVCSize: "2Mi",
expansionAllowed: true,
},
{
label: "case 5: storage class does not allow expansion",
currentPVCSize: "1Mi",
desiredPVCSize: "2Mi",
expansionAllowed: false,
},
}
storageClass := &storagev1.StorageClass{
ObjectMeta: metav1.ObjectMeta{
Name: "test",
},
}
desiredPVC := &v1.PersistentVolumeClaim{
ObjectMeta: metav1.ObjectMeta{
Name: "test",
Namespace: "rook-ceph",
},
Spec: v1.PersistentVolumeClaimSpec{
AccessModes: []v1.PersistentVolumeAccessMode{
v1.ReadWriteOnce,
},
Resources: v1.ResourceRequirements{
Requests: v1.ResourceList{
v1.ResourceName(v1.ResourceStorage): apiresource.MustParse("1Mi"),
},
},
StorageClassName: &storageClass.ObjectMeta.Name,
},
}
for _, tc := range testcases {
desiredPVC.Spec.Resources.Requests[v1.ResourceStorage] = apiresource.MustParse(tc.currentPVCSize)
storageClass.AllowVolumeExpansion = &tc.expansionAllowed
// create fake client with PVC
cl := fake.NewClientBuilder().WithRuntimeObjects(desiredPVC, storageClass).Build()
// get existing PVC
existingPVC := &v1.PersistentVolumeClaim{}
err := cl.Get(context.TODO(), client.ObjectKey{Name: "test", Namespace: "rook-ceph"}, existingPVC)
assert.NoError(t, err)
desiredPVC.Spec.Resources.Requests[v1.ResourceStorage] = apiresource.MustParse(tc.desiredPVCSize)
ExpandPVCIfRequired(context.TODO(), cl, desiredPVC, existingPVC)
// get existing PVC
err = cl.Get(context.TODO(), client.ObjectKey{Name: "test", Namespace: "rook-ceph"}, existingPVC)
assert.NoError(t, err)
// verify size
if tc.currentPVCSize <= tc.desiredPVCSize && tc.expansionAllowed {
assert.Equal(t, desiredPVC.Spec.Resources.Requests[v1.ResourceStorage], existingPVC.Spec.Resources.Requests[v1.ResourceStorage])
} else {
assert.Equal(t, apiresource.MustParse(tc.currentPVCSize), existingPVC.Spec.Resources.Requests[v1.ResourceStorage])
}
}
}
